well, the fact is strong only make one licenced irdeto box.

4658x etc. boxes are CONAX , not irdeto. yes, they work on irdeto most of the time, and if they don't then bad luck.

spend some money and buy a box that works....

for aurora i would suggest an opentel or uec, they may be a bit basic, but they are licenced irdeto boxes.

they work and will keep on working.
